Log:
[Support] Add case-insensitive versions of StringSwitch members.

This adds support for CaseLower, CasesLower, StartsWithLower, and
EndsWithLower.

+  // Case-insensitive case matchers.
+  template <unsigned N>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&CaseLower(const char (&S)[N],
+                                                       const T &Value) {
+    if (!Result && Str.equals_lower(StringRef(S, N - 1)))
+      Result = &Value;
+
+    return *this;
+  }
+
+  template <unsigned N>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&EndsWithLower(const char (&S)[N],
+                                                           const T &Value) {
+    if (!Result && Str.endswith_lower(StringRef(S, N - 1)))
+      Result = &Value;
+
+    return *this;
+  }
+
+  template <unsigned N>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&StartsWithLower(const char (&S)[N],
+                                                             const T &Value) {
+    if (!Result && Str.startswith_lower(StringRef(S, N - 1)))
+      Result = &Value;
+
+    return *this;
+  }
+  template <unsigned N0, unsigned N1>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&
+  CasesLower(const char (&S0)[N0], const char (&S1)[N1], const T &Value) {
+    return CaseLower(S0, Value).CaseLower(S1, Value);
+  }
+
+  template <unsigned N0, unsigned N1, unsigned N2>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&
+  CasesLower(const char (&S0)[N0], const char (&S1)[N1], const char (&S2)[N2],
+             const T &Value) {
+    return CaseLower(S0, Value).CasesLower(S1, S2, Value);
+  }
+
+  template <unsigned N0, unsigned N1, unsigned N2, unsigned N3>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&
+  CasesLower(const char (&S0)[N0], const char (&S1)[N1], const char (&S2)[N2],
+             const char (&S3)[N3], const T &Value) {
+    return CaseLower(S0, Value).CasesLower(S1, S2, S3, Value);
+  }
+
+  template <unsigned N0, unsigned N1, unsigned N2, unsigned N3, unsigned N4>
+  LLVM_ATTRIBUTE_ALWAYS_INLINE StringSwitch &
+  CasesLower(const char (&S0)[N0], const char (&S1)[N1], const char (&S2)[N2],
+             const char (&S3)[N3], const char (&S4)[N4], const T &Value) {
+    return CaseLower(S0, Value).CasesLower(S1, S2, S3, S4, Value);
+  }
+

+TEST(StringSwitchTest, CaseLower) {
+  auto Translate = [](StringRef S) {
+    return llvm::StringSwitch<int>(S)
+        .Case("0", 0)
+        .Case("1", 1)
+        .Case("2", 2)
+        .Case("3", 3)
+        .Case("4", 4)
+        .Case("5", 5)
+        .Case("6", 6)
+        .Case("7", 7)
+        .Case("8", 8)
+        .Case("9", 9)
+        .CaseLower("A", 10)
+        .CaseLower("B", 11)
+        .CaseLower("C", 12)
+        .CaseLower("D", 13)
+        .CaseLower("E", 14)
+        .CaseLower("F", 15)
+        .Default(-1);
+  };
+  EXPECT_EQ(1, Translate("1"));
+  EXPECT_EQ(2, Translate("2"));
+  EXPECT_EQ(11, Translate("B"));
+  EXPECT_EQ(11, Translate("b"));
+
+  EXPECT_EQ(-1, Translate(""));
+  EXPECT_EQ(-1, Translate("Test"));
+}
